Cedep petitions UN on media freedoms

Centre for the Development of People (Cedep) has petitioned the Office of the United Nations High Commissioner for Human Rights (OHCHR) expressing concern over Malawi Government’s attempts to suppress media freedom.

Cedep has taken the step in the wake of recent government actions through Malawi Communications Regulatory Authority (Macra) to exerted pressure on different independent media houses to have certain programmes and columns removed from their schedules.

“As you might recall, in September this year, we sent to your office different issues on human rights violations in Malawi. Among the issues raised was the suppression of press and media freedom by the government through the Malawi Communications Regulatory Authority.

“The issues of suppression of press and media freedom have resurfaced in Malawi and all caution has been thrown to the wind in as far as safeguarding press and media freedom is concerned,” reads part of the petition signed by Cedep executive director Gift Trapence. n
